Prerequisite Clearance Request

What is a prerequisite clearance request?

If you received a Pre-requisite and Test Score Error during registration, please check the prerequisites by clicking on the CRN of your chosen course from the Class Schedule. These courses must be completed before enrolling your selected course.

If you believe you have met the prerequisites for the course with a course completed at another regionally accredited college, you may submit a prerequisite clearance request. Please see below.

SUBMISSION REQUIREMENTS

Pre-requisite Clearance Request must be submitted at least 10 days before your registration appointment. Please allow 5 to 7 business days for processing. Please upload any necessary unofficial documents (transcripts, AP scores, etc.) with this request.

If your official transcripts are already on file with the Admissions and Records Office, you will not need to upload additional unofficial documents.

To clear a prerequisite, you will need to submit a Clearance Request Form and attach the proper documentation that demonstrates you have completed one of the following:

College Transcript (Official/Unofficial):
Students who have completed a prerequisite course with a C or better from an accredited college or university that is considered an equivalent course at GWC.

1. A "C-" grade is not a passing grade at GWC and will not be accepted.


2. Attempting a prerequisite class and withdrawing from the class with a "W" does not meet the criteria for clearing a prerequisite (A "W" is a notation, not a grade). Students may submit unofficial transcripts for prerequisite and co-requisite clearance ONLY. Students MUST submit official transcripts if they wish to receive course credit/units towards Degrees, certificates, or General Education Certification (CSU GE Breadth or IGETC).


AP Scores:
Students who have taken AP tests in English, Psychology, and/or Math with a score of 3 or higher.(AP Calculus AB. AP Calculus BC. AP English Literature and Composition. AP English Language and Composition exam. AP Psychology).

To access your AP results, please go to www.collegeboard.org. Sign in with your account information or create a new account. Click on the "AP" tab at the top of the page.

NOTE: This prerequisite clearance only clears the prerequisites at GWC. OCC and CCC's prerequisites must be cleared with them.

Pre-requisite/Co-requisite Challenge Form:
Students who submit a Clearance Request Form and are denied can challenge a prerequisite based on previous experience or knowledge. A prerequisite/co-requisite challenge requires written documentation, an explanation of alternative coursework, and background or abilities that adequately prepare the student for the course.

Reasons for seeking a Pre-requisite/Co-requisite Challenge Form may include one or more of the following:

1. A prerequisite/co-requisite is not reasonably available;
2. The student believes the prerequisite/co-requisite was established in violation of regulation or in violation of the District-approved processes;
3. The student believes the prerequisite/co-requisite is discriminatory or is being applied in a discriminatory manner; or
4. The student has the documented knowledge or ability to succeed in the course without meeting the prerequisite/co-requisite.
